Demographic Profile
Ethnic composition, age structure, and growth.
- Nationality
- Greenlander(s)
- Ethnic Groups
- Greenlander 88% (Inuit and Greenland-born whites), Danish and others 12%
- Population
- 56,370
- Population in Major Urban Areas
- NUUK (capital) 16,000

Life expectancy at birth in Greenland stands at approximately 73 years overall, with notable differences between male and female populations. Women in Greenland can expect to live to around 76 years, while men have a life expectancy of closer to 70 years — a gap that reflects broader patterns seen across Arctic and subarctic populations. These figures place Greenland notably below the averages of neighboring Denmark, which administers the island as an autonomous territory, where life expectancy exceeds 81 years.
